Output 3b157db783d9a065346bddea6f408036ab506ba8c7c7b74daa4ba87db706e5e0:7

value
158399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91630eaf569ca20438666b5b1c77028e1b9ce9e8 OP_EQUAL
address
3EwkZz79cFTkUXYCCJmrhuYrRH3qaitxeZ
transaction
3b157db783d9a065346bddea6f408036ab506ba8c7c7b74daa4ba87db706e5e0
confirmations
138745
spent
true